Wadi Wan Tkofy is a remote valley near Ghat in southwestern Libya where unusual round and disk-shaped rock formations dot a wide desert plain. The rocks look like giant stones from another world, so locals and visitors often call the area the Valley of the Planets. This strange landscape is the result of long geological processes that carved and shaped the sandstone into smooth boulders and carved pillars.

The rounded boulders and disk-like stones are visually striking. They range in size from small pebbles to meters-wide spheres and often sit alone or in small groups on a flat ground.

The rocks are shaped by erosion and cementation processes that acted over millions of years. Geologists compare these features to similar formations called trovants or concretions found in other parts of the world.

The setting is empty desert with clear light and wide horizons. That openness makes the round stones stand out and creates dramatic photo opportunities at sunrise and sunset.
